Why We’re F*cked

If it feels like everything is crumbling all around you, it’s not your imagination. It’s the result of a snowball that has grown into an unstoppable avalanche, the 70 year assault on the New Deal and, yes, it is unstoppable. Get used to that ugly reality. Though the Republicans had made a few missteps shortly after the passage of the National Labor Relations Act in 1935, the magic formula for undoing the entire New Deal slowly emerged by the 1960′s as William Buckley and his ilk came onto the scene and intellectualized the conservative Republican agenda. The growth of think-tanks (AEI, which had its roots in the mid-1940s; Cato Institute; the Heritage Foundation, etc.) altered the way we see the world, changing the agenda and demonizing everything that had to do with the New Deal. We see the result of that now. Unions, which gave us 8-hour work days, pensions, vacations, are evil. (How many of you who just read the previous sentence thought to yourselves, “But what about the bad things the unions have done?” If that’s what you thought then you have succumbed to the conservative agenda.) Government programs, no matter how successful, are evil. Public education? Evil. Publicly-regulated utilities? Evil. Environmental regulation? Evil. The list goes on. The Reagan presidency helped to solidify the growing assault on all things related to the New Deal and added a new twist to it all. If you do something illegal, all you need do is claim you are doing it for the good of the country. Ollie North was the model for this type of patriotic propaganda. When Gingrich came to town in 1994 with his Contract for America, despite his ethical lapses, he helped set the mold for our current adversial-type government. By the time Bush came into office, the conservative Republican agenda had been pretty well solidified from the ground up: conservative judges on many levels up to the Supreme Court; conservative “grass roots” organization; laws to prevent voter fraud that are really mean to prevent voting; conservative politicians from the smallest level up to governors, congressional representatives and senators; mass media (cable; print; radio). The list goes on and on and on. Almost everywhere you turn, in almost every aspect of our social and political life, the Republican agenda has become the norm. So what can be done to reverse this?
